General information Xeon D-2796TE Core i5-11400
Launched Q4 2022 Q1 2021
Used in Server Desktop
Factory Intel Intel
Socket FCBGA2579 FCLGA1200
Clock 2 GHz 23.1 % 2.6 GHz 0 %
Turbo Clock 3.1 GHz 29.5 % 4.4 GHz 0 %
Cores 20 0 % 6 70 %
Threads 40 0 % 12 70 %
Thermal Design Power (TDP) 118 W 0 % 65 W 44.9 %
